How the two options compare

Appearance

Invisalign uses a series of clear, removable aligners that are nearly invisible. Braces are fixed to the teeth, though our tooth-colored GC Chic ceramic option blends in far more than most people expect.

Comfort and daily life

Aligners are smooth and removable, so eating, brushing, and flossing stay simple. Modern braces are more comfortable than ever too: our self-ligating brackets use a built-in clip instead of elastic ties, making them easier to clean and often reducing adjustment visits.

Precision and complexity

For mild to moderate cases, both options deliver excellent results. For more complex tooth movements and bite corrections, braces give us stronger, more precise control. We use AI-assisted digital planning for custom braces, mapping bracket placement on a digital model before bonding day.

Discipline required

Aligners only work while you wear them, so Invisalign rewards consistency. Braces work around the clock without any willpower required, often the deciding factor for younger patients.

Appointments

With Invisalign, many visits can be spaced out or handled remotely. Braces require periodic in-office adjustments, though self-ligating designs often mean fewer of them.

What about cost?

The honest answer: it depends on your case, not the appliance. Treatment complexity and length drive cost more than the choice between aligners and brackets. Which is right for kids, teens, and adults?

Kids: We offer growth-guided options including Invisalign First and kid-friendly braces like Wild Smiles. The right choice depends on how your child’s jaw and airway are developing.

Teens: Both work well. Aligners suit responsible wearers who want discretion; braces remove the “did you wear them?” question entirely.

Adults: Adult treatment is never too late. Many adults choose Invisalign or clear ceramic braces for a low-profile look that fits work and life.

Invisalign vs braces: your questions answered

Is Invisalign cheaper than braces?

Not necessarily. For many cases the costs are comparable, and the real driver is the complexity of your treatment. We’ll give you exact numbers for both at your free consultation.

Which works faster?

It depends on the case. Some mild cases move quickly with aligners; complex corrections are often more efficient with braces. Your personalized timeline comes with your consultation.

Can Invisalign fix bite problems like overbites?

Often, yes, for many mild to moderate cases. For more significant corrections, braces may give us the precision we need. Learn more on our overbite and deep bite page.

Can I switch between them mid-treatment?

In some cases, yes. If your needs or preferences change, we’ll talk through whether a switch makes sense for your plan.

Do both require a retainer afterward?

Yes. Whichever path you choose, retainers protect your investment. We offer Hawley, Vivera, bonded, and Essix options.
